Question

A catcher catches a fastball going 95mi/hr and recoils 12cm while stopping the ball in 0.005s. (mass of the ball is 280g).


a) What was the magnitude and direction of the change in momentum of the ball?  

b) What was the average force the ball exerts on the hand & glove?

Explanation / Answer

a) dp = m dv = .28*42.47=11.89


b) F = dp/dt = 11.89/0.005=2378 N
